Transaction d53bc957d8a55984fa2fc96bc4366f8589047c749e4786de7950033c5a106768
1 Input
2 Outputs
- d53bc957d8a55984fa2fc96bc4366f8589047c749e4786de7950033c5a106768:0
- d53bc957d8a55984fa2fc96bc4366f8589047c749e4786de7950033c5a106768:1
value 1898313
address 15bRR1yLSDiuJs6N84grEvWZS4BSv6fxpG
value 1248543711
address 15WRyDXNkerzNNfKXXfhopCF3opDFXSAVM